Output 4b31e21ce400a25da14b24b9dce8a79d936f72c7425c56a8a519c8a3f46ec8bf:0

value
3503445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e816b5b5bd8f35079818c02014b046e95dfde8d2 OP_EQUAL
address
3NrBtxF6YfCHV45BusDom9EhcFhkgqGj8b
transaction
4b31e21ce400a25da14b24b9dce8a79d936f72c7425c56a8a519c8a3f46ec8bf
confirmations
119916
spent
true